2017-10-18 2 views
6

私は輸入にGoogleのキーファイルをアップロードしてAPKに署名するにはどうすればよいですか?続く</p> <pre><code>keytool -keystore my-release-key.keystore -importcert -file ~/Downloads/upload_cert.der -alias uploadcert </code></pre> <p>としてキーストアにDERファイルをインポートした後

-protected 

を追加した場合は解除APK

trusted certificate entries are not password-protected 

を組み立てるしようとしたとき、私はエラーを取得します、私は

keytool error: java.lang.IllegalArgumentException: password can't be null 

パスワードを守った後にパスワードを渡すと、使用方法のヘルプメッセージが表示されます。 パスワードの受け渡し方法が不明です。

私は正しいパスにGoogleのアップロード証明書デルファイルで署名するかどうかは何ですか?

答えて

2

は同じ問題とパスワードがnullで問題になることはできませんガットのようなコメント編集して渡されます:

keytool -keystore parkimayaz.keystore -importcert -file 
~/Downloads/upload_cert.der -alias uploadcert -keypass "yourpass" - 
storepass "yourpass" 

私が(^、#、」)のような文字を使用する別の情報をどのパスワードの一部に私にいくつかの誤りを与えました。

さらにご覧くださいoracle keytool docs

+0

どうすれば入手できますか? keytool -listの後に次のように入力すると、:: java.lang.Exceptionと表示されます:キーストアファイルが存在しません:/Users/myuser/.keystore – CarLoOSX

関連する問題

 関連する問題